The North Korean Connection: Allegations of Arms Supply & Component Origins

A particularly concerning advancement is the allegation by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y that a Russian missile fired at Kyiv was manufactured in North Korea and contained components of American origin.This claim, if substantiated, raises serious questions about the circumvention of international sanctions against North Korea and the potential for sensitive technology to fall into the hands of opposed actors.

While North Korea has a history of arms sales, particularly to countries under international embargo, the direct provision of complete missile systems to Russia represents a significant escalation. Experts suggest that North Korea possesses substantial stockpiles of Soviet-era weaponry and the capacity to produce ballistic missiles, making it a potential supplier for Russia as its own domestic arms production struggles to meet the demands of the war.

The assertion regarding American components is equally troubling. Investigations are underway to determine how these parts ended up in the missile, with possibilities ranging from intentional diversion through third-party suppliers to unintentional inclusion via the global supply chain.The US government has stated it is indeed taking the allegations seriously and is investigating the matter thoroughly.

Putin’s Conditional Offer: A Path to De-escalation or Strategic Maneuvering?

Putin’s stated readiness to negotiate, reported by numerous international news outlets, isn’t a sudden shift in policy. Rather, it’s presented with significant conditions. Moscow insists on the complete withdrawal of Ukrainian forces from the territories currently occupied by Russia – including Crimea, annexed in 2014, and the regions of Donetsk, Luhansk, Zaporizhzhia, and kherson, which Russia illegally declared as part of its territory in 2022. Moreover, Russia demands guarantees regarding Ukraine’s neutrality, preventing its future membership in NATO.These demands, viewed by Ukraine and its allies as non-starters, raise questions about the sincerity of the offer. some analysts suggest it’s a strategic move designed to sow discord among Western supporters of Ukraine, potentially leveraging war fatigue and economic pressures to force concessions. As of April 27, 2025, ukraine holds approximately 17.5% of its territory under Russian occupation, a figure that underscores the scale of the challenge facing any potential negotiations. Recent reports from the Institute for the Study of War indicate a continued, albeit slowed, Russian offensive in the eastern Donbas region, suggesting Moscow isn’t actively seeking a complete ceasefire while maintaining its territorial gains.

Trump’s Remarks: A Pattern of Ambiguity and Personal Reflections

Former President Trump’s reaction to Putin’s offer, as reported across various news sources, has been characteristically unconventional. he questioned Putin’s motivations, suggesting, “Maybe he walks me,” implying a personal dynamic and a perceived ability to influence the Russian leader. This statement, lacking concrete policy proposals, echoes Trump’s past rhetoric regarding his relationships with authoritarian figures.

Trump’s comments stand in stark contrast to the unified stance of current U.S. policy, which emphasizes unwavering support for Ukraine’s sovereignty and territorial integrity. While acknowledging the desire for peace, the Biden management has consistently maintained that any negotiations must be conducted on Ukraine’s terms and cannot involve ceding territory to Russia. Trump’s focus on a personal connection, rather than strategic considerations, has drawn criticism from both sides of the political spectrum. It’s a continuation of a pattern observed during his presidency, where foreign policy was often framed through the lens of personal relationships.
